On Saturday night in Brooklyn, New York, Keith "One Time" Thurman (28-0-1,22 KOs) scored a split-decision win (116-112, 115-113, 113-115) over Danny Garcia (33-1, 19 KOs). It wasn't an action-packed fight, but it was a good professional performance between undefeated, elite fighters in their prime. That's what boxing fans have been begging for, but will it be enough to grow the audience for boxing in America? Early on, Thurman vs. Garcia looked like it was going to be a replay of Thurman vs. Shawn Porter last year. When we do see an all-out action fight, it gives us something to appreciate.
